Job Description

PlayStation Creative Studios is seeking a talented Contract Brand Designer to support Bungie. The Brand Designer will join a multi-disciplinary group to produce creative designs that establish, elevate, support, and extend the Bungie brand across marketing channels. The role involves conceptualizing and executing creative solutions for internal and external marketing campaigns, working directly with Creative Directors, brand management, art directors, and production. This role is essential in maintaining and evolving the brand guidelines for Bungie and establishing a systematic design approach to creative needs.

Responsibilities:

  • Design and maintain brand design systems and visual design for publishing, marketing, and sales for Bungie.
  • Collaborate with Creative Studios disciplines, Internal Stakeholders, Brand Management, and Marketing Directors.
  • Create and systemize designs with a focus on major marketing channels.
  • Design and deliver high-volume static assets across platforms in multiple languages and formats.
  • Design branded presentations and style-guide documentation.
  • Work with Creative Directors, producers, brand managers, and art directors to ensure design quality.
  • Participate in design reviews and provide actionable feedback.

Required Skills:

  • Strong portfolio demonstrating creative excellence and brand development.
  • Understanding of design sensibilities in line with Bungie Brand style and aesthetics.
  • 2-4 years of experience as a brand designer or graphic designer.
  • Expert knowledge in Adobe Creative Suite.
  • Passion for design fundamentals.
  • Ability to iterate through design details and communicate ideas concisely.
  • Flexible and adaptable in a fast-paced environment.
  • Professional attitude and ability to take constructive criticism.
  • Experience working with a cross-disciplinary design team.

Nice-to-Have Skills:

  • Bachelor's degree in Communications Design, Graphic Design, Fine Arts, or related area.
  • Experience with After Effects and Motion Graphics pipelines.
  • Experience with best practices for social content and platforms.
  • Avid first-person shooter player and passion for Bungie.
  • Familiarity with Bungie’s current and past releases.
